Newtonsoft.Json利用IsoDateTimeConverter处理日期类型
来源:互联网 发布:单片机一脚是哪个 编辑:程序博客网 时间:2024/06/04 23:07
Newtonsoft.Json.dll来序列化反序列化对象和Json字符串时非常方便
但是如果对象中存在日期类型属性时,序列化后格式是
其中日期会被转换成Date(353521211984),其中Date代表的是日期,353521211984是毫秒
上面的格式看起来非常不方便,所以我们应该转换成普通的日期格式如:2013-01-15 12:13:14
Newtonsoft.Json里面有一个类IsoDateTimeConverter可以转换日期,下面是转换的方法
利用IsoDateTimeConverter转换后结果
上面是序列化一个对象,下面是序列化对象集合注意: timeConverter.DateTimeFormat只有Newtonsoft.Json.dll(3.5)版本才有,2.0的没有
在使用时候,注意查看ewtonsoft.Json.dll的版本跟当前程序的.net 版本是否相同,不然会报下面错误:
未能加载文件或程序集“Newtonsoft.Json, Version=3.5.0.0, Culture=neutral, PublicKeyToken=b9a188c8922137c6”或它的某一个依赖项。找到的程序集清单定义与程序集引用不匹配。 (异常来自 HRESULT:0x80131040)
Newtonsoft.Json.dll下载地址:
http://json.codeplex.com/releases/view/97986
阅读全文
0 0
- Newtonsoft.Json利用IsoDateTimeConverter处理日期类型
- Newtonsoft.Json利用IsoDateTimeConverter处理日期类型
- Newtonsoft.Json日期格式定义
- 使用Newtonsoft.Json.dll处理json
- Newtonsoft.Json.JsonConvert 序列化日期时间
- SpringMVC ResponseBody 日期类型Json 处理
- Newtonsoft.Json
- Newtonsoft.Json
- Newtonsoft.Json
- Newtonsoft.Json
- C#解析Json数据(利用Newtonsoft.Json库)
- SQL中采用Newtonsoft.Json处理json字符串
- 使用Newtonsoft.Json处理含有未知节点的JSON
- 利用Newtonsoft.Json序列化,反序列化,读取,写入
- 利用Newtonsoft把Datatable转换成JSON格式的字符串
- .Net利用Newtonsoft进行解析Json的快捷方法
- Spring MVC 4.X ResponseBody 日期类型Json 处理
- 处理Json数据中的日期类型.如/Date(1415169703000)/格式
- PyCharm使用
- git学习笔记 -- day01 原理、安装、工作流程、三种装态、设置个人信息
- 系统分析与设计--学习笔记2
- jsp 往后台传值乱码问题
- spark-redis入门教程
- Newtonsoft.Json利用IsoDateTimeConverter处理日期类型
- 你该拥有自己的一套项目结构----Kotlin+Dagger2+MVP+Rx+Retrofit
- IntelliJ Idea 常用快捷键列表
- Spring整合Shiro做权限控制模块详细案例分析
- promise
- 一个WebSocket客户端的JavaScript例子
- cgi, fastcgi
- WebAssembly,Web的新时代
- 安卓中实现如何让下载好的apk自动进入安装界面